Description :

A Depth Gauge is a precision measuring instrument used to accurately determine the depth of holes, slots, recesses, or other cavities in materials or components. It ensures precise measurements in machining, engineering, quality control, and laboratory applications.

Features:

  • Material: High-quality stainless steel or hardened alloy for durability and corrosion resistance

  • Measurement Range: Available in various ranges depending on application (e.g., 0–150 mm, 0–300 mm)

  • Accuracy: Provides precise readings with fine graduations or vernier scale

  • Design: Lightweight, ergonomic, and easy to handle

  • Types: Manual vernier depth gauge, digital depth gauge, or dial depth gauge

Applications:

  • Measuring the depth of drilled holes, recesses, or grooves in metal, wood, or plastic

  • Ensuring dimensional accuracy in manufacturing and machining

  • Quality control in laboratories, workshops, and industrial setups
